FAQs

Are these batteries rechargeable?

No, these are primary, non-rechargeable lithium batteries.

Can I use these in my TV remote?

Yes, they are compatible, though they are best suited for high-drain devices.

How do these compare to standard alkaline AA batteries?

They offer higher capacity, better performance in extreme temperatures, and a more stable voltage output.

Is the 1.5V output safe for my electronics?

Yes, 1.5V is the standard voltage for most AA-compatible electronic devices.

What happens if they get wet?

While they feature leak-proof protection, they should be kept dry to prevent corrosion on external contacts.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To ensure maximum lifespan and safety, verify that your device is compatible with 1.5V lithium-ion batteries. While they are a drop-in replacement for standard AA size, avoid mixing these with older batteries or different chemical types in the same device. Store the batteries in a cool, dry place when not in use. Even though these batteries feature advanced leak-proof technology, it is recommended to remove them from devices if they will be left unused for extended periods (several months or more) to prevent potential corrosion on device terminals.
